Subtilization
Pronunciation : Sub`til*i*za"tion
Part of Speech : n.
Etymology : [Cf. F. subtilization.]
Definition : 1. The act of making subtile.
2. (Old Chem.)
Defn: The operation of making so volatile as to rise in steam or vapor.
3. Refinement; subtlety; extreme attenuation.
Source : Webster's Unabridged Dictionary, 1913
